Does anyone else get a blurry live feed from the Mavic only in photo mode?  After they're taken, photos look fine -- very sharp and in focus.  And the live feed in video mode (4K 24 fps) is sharp too.  But switch into photo mode and no amount of focusing will sharpen up the live feed.
Just curious.  Not a horrible, since the photos are fine, but not ideal.  And weird.

Mine does something similar. This is my third Mavic and my previous two did not do this. The video feed looks great when recording video but as soon as I switch to photo mode the live feed almost looks a little cartoonish. It doesn't save that way to the SD card, only on the live feed both on my iPhone and my CrystalSky. It's annoying because I am relying on what I see in the live feed to try and adjust settings for the photo I'm taking. It was like this straight out of the box from DJI. But I just live with it rather than try to deal with DJI support...

NOTE: it is not a signal strength issue for me. This happens when my aircraft is 15 feet away with full signal strength.

A 720p video stream can come down from either a 4K raw or a 720p raw, which have very different sharpness. In photo live preview, the sensor works at a raw readout mode very different from still or video capture, like every ordinary camera (which often have much smaller EVF than our app display and the user can't determine if it's blurry).
